Celebrity Disguises That Failed to Convince Audiences

The allure of fame brings both adulation and constant scrutiny. While the public may view a celebrity's life as glamorous, the reality includes relentless attention from paparazzi. Navigating everyday tasks can become fraught with unwanted cameras.

In recent weeks, actors Jacob Elordi and Kendall Jenner attempted to conceal themselves at Brisbane Airport by covering their bodies in layers of clothing. Despite their efforts, they were quickly identified and photographed by media outlets.

In 2009, singer Katy Perry arrived at Miami International Airport wearing a large plush donut pillow. The oversized prop was intended to act as a shield against cameras, though it also drew curious glances.

Actor Millie Bobby Brown, known for her role in a popular series, tried a more elaborate ruse at Milan’s Malpensa Airport in 2023. She placed a cardboard box over her head, even drawing a face that matched her outfit to create a false identity.

During a 2013 tour stop in London, pop star Justin Bieber covered his face with a gas mask in an attempt to evade photographers. The tactic failed to obscure his features and he was still photographed.

In 2002, singer Jennifer Lopez used a napkin to shield her face while dining at a Beverly Hills restaurant. The gesture, meant to block cameras, ultimately proved ineffective as paparazzi focused on her partner instead.

Actor Brad Pitt tried to blend into a crowd by pulling a woolly hat over his face while leaving a New York coffee shop in 1995. The disguise did not prevent him from being captured on camera.

Halloween provided an excuse for actresses Sandra Bullock and Melissa McCarthy to don matching yellow fisherman outfits complete with beards in 2013. Their playful costumes attracted attention from the press.

Veteran actor Dustin Hoffman has experimented with various concealments, from hiding behind tree branches to placing a bag on his head after a shopping trip. Even with eye holes cut, he was still photographed.

Singer Lily Allen wrapped herself in a comforter while walking Manhattan streets in 2009, hoping the blanket would shield her from cameras. The attempt did not succeed in preventing photographs.

In 2005, actor Tobey Maguire covered his face with a snowboard while attending a film festival. The unusual disguise was not enough to keep him out of the spotlight.

These anecdotes illustrate that, despite creative efforts, celebrities frequently find themselves photographed. The persistent presence of paparazzi continues to challenge those seeking privacy.
